- the present invention relates to a dual single reed module, in particular provided to be placed in a two-way wind instrument wind like an accordion.
- an accordion includes two boxes connected by a bellows forming a speaker. On each of these boxes, in the enclosure, there are tables of harmony provided with openings, release and shutter mechanisms of these openings. These soundboards generally carry several box springs which are supports for many modules also called "music" in the domain of accordion manufacturers. These modules are placed opposite the openings to be crossed or not by the air flows generated by the bellows, depending on the keys pressed.
- Each module is in fact the sound production element and includes a blade holder.
- a module includes two windows, each with a slat fixed by a of its ends provided with a heel on said blade holder. The blade extends by its free part also called tab in this window.
- This tab vibrated by the air flow passing through the window, used to produce sounds.
- each module includes, for the same note two windows and two blades for each of the two possible wind directions.
- One of slats are riveted on one side of the module opposite the first window and the other blade is riveted on the other face opposite the other window.
- Each window is provided, on the face of the module opposite to that which carries the blade a valve, generally made of flexible material, more particularly leather.
- the corresponding blade is put in vibration and produces the note while the valve on the other window limits the air leakage by the other window.
- German patent No. 34 13 382 describes a reed which can operate in the two directions, the tongue remaining in the same position and the complete frame being moved on either side of the plane of the tongue to respect a certain dissymmetry.
- the purpose of the present invention is to provide a musical module with a single dual reed, that is to say that works in both directions of the wind.
- This module as presented in the description which follows, can be implemented industrially. This module overcomes the constraints related to maintenance, considerably reduces the number of pieces because in addition to dividing by two the number of blades, the valves are eliminated as well as the associated fixing and / or elastic return elements.
- FIG. 1 there is shown a box spring 10 of the prior art supporting several modules 12.
- Each module includes a blade holder 14 with two windows 16 formed through said blade holder, a blade 18 fixed on each face of the blade holder, opposite the corresponding window, each blade having a heel 20 and a tongue 22 capable of vibrating freely in the window 16 associated.
- Each heel 20 is fixed to the blade holder preferably by a rivet 24 which has the advantage of not unscrewing under the effects of vibrations.
- each blade is curved towards the outside of the blade holder, so as to leave a gap i between the plane of said blade and the plan of the blade holder.
- the dimensions of the blade holders are 18 to 50 mm long for 2 to 5 mm in wide and 2 to 5 mm thick to give orders of ideas.
- the tongues are a few tenths of a millimeter thick.
